/// A type allows to
/// - check that zero-copy succeed by ?.is_ok()
/// - check that zero-copy failed, but read/write fallback succeed by ?.is_err()
/// - catch the read/write fallback's error by ? or let Err(e)
///
/// use rustix::io::Result for functions without read/write fallback
type PipeRes = std::io::Result<Result<(), ()>>;
